Welcome! My classes are very demonstration heavy, so you will learn a lot. Bring a notebook for note taking and of course all of your supplies and questions! Our lessons will be focused on animal and landscape painting techniques for ALL levels with a focus on TEXTURE and SPECIAL EFFECTS. Structure and flow of lessons will be grouped into themes: trees & grasses, skies and water, rocks and cliffs, texture and animal features from equine & bovine to wildlife (such as wolves and elk.) PAINTS: We use tubes only. BE READY FOR CLASS! Recommended TUBE Artist Brands: Winsor & Newton. Da Vinci or High end “STUDENT” quality brand such as Cotman. Squeeze out into a palette as shown on next page. They should be DRIED for travel. You may need to bring extra tubes depending on how many days you attend.

Please do not use PAN sets as they are typically disappointingly under-pigmented. THE ONLY PAN SET I would recommend would be Richeson “St Petersburg” Set of watercolour paints “ULTIMATE set” SKU# 58036. https://www.madisonartshop.com/58036.html

Otherwise tube colours as indicated (or something similar) • Hansa light • Gamboge (or New gamboge) • Permanent • Alizarin crimson • Prussian • Ultramarine Blue • Raw sienna • Burnt sienna • Burnt umber • Hookers dark (NOTE it must say DEEP or DARK…if you cannot find this then a PHTAHLO GREEN will be ok) • green • Violet (ie: “dioxazine” or “winsor violet” or “Da Vinci Violet”) • Permanent rose • Phthalo Blue (do not buy “green shade”) • Paynes Grey (missing from chart but can be placed near ) *OPTIONAL tube of opaque white guoache

PAPER: A BLOCK or PAD of 11” x14” 140lb COLD PRESSED 100% RAG paper in BRIGHT WHITE (Recommended Brands: Winsor & Newton or Arches or Fabriano). NOTE: YOU WILL NEED several loose sheets of wc paper as well for tests and colour charts / exercises that are not tied up in a block.

BRUSHES: • Synthetic or Natural Hair washbrush, 1 .” • White Nylon bristle #0 round (for masking fluid) • #3 round (kolinsky sable or synthetic blend) • #6 round (kolinsky sable or synthetic blend) • # 8 or 10 round (kolinsky sable or synthetic blend) • ½” flat • .5” flat • 1” or 1.5” fan brush or synthetic fan brush ( I will bring some of these magical little wizardsfrom of my own line of brushes for purchase @ 15.99 cash or credit accepted)

PALETTE:

My favourite STUDIO palette: https://www.dickblick.com/products/masterson-aqua-pro-watercolor-palette/ OR A smaller folding palette might e easier to travel with especially if you are planning on joining me for an outdoor session. https://www.dickblick.com/products/large-plastic-folding-palette/

Regardless of what you choose….Your palette needs to have as many wells as you have tubes of paint. PLUS at least 6 areas for pools of paint. SQUEEZE your paints out according to the diagram on the next page

OTHER: • Masking fluid: “Pebeo drawing gum” 45ml is my favoutite (whatever you use – be sure it is a Bottle of REMOVABLE masking) • • 1” masking tape (medium tack) • two plastic water containers ie: margarine or yogurt containers or even collapsible travel bowls • Plain Notebook or sketchbook 8”x10” or 9”x12” max • 2H pencil, HB pencil • White vinyl eraser • Kneadable eraser • Box of Kleenex • paper Towel ROLL or WHITE rags • A thin palette knife or utility knife for releasing your watercolour sheets from your block. • REFERENCE PHOTOS (email me for the digital files and also bring some of your own to work from if you like)

Classes will be primarily IN STUDIO however, we will do one optional excursion to one of the ranches in Dubois. For Plein Aire Painting you would need to augment some of the above: • a smaller travel palette • travel stool • stable water containers • travel case for your brushes • perhaps a back pack for your supplies as opposed to the tote bag.
